encompasses a vital approach to treating substance use disorders, particularly opioid addiction and alcohol dependency. Rehab centers for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ver employ a combination of medications, counseling, and behavioral therapies to address the complex nature of addiction. These centers cater to individuals struggling with various forms of addiction, including heroin, prescription painkillers, and alcohol. By utilizing medication-assisted treatment, patients are not only eased through withdrawal symptoms but also supported in developing coping strategies necessary for long-term sobriety. The importance of rehab centers cannot be overstated; they provide a structured and supportive environment where individuals can focus on recovery without the distractions and triggers present in their daily lives. Historically, the inception of medication-assisted treatment in the United States can be traced back to the introduction of methadone for treating opioid addiction in the 1960s. Since then, the landscape has evolved significantly, and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ver have played a crucial role in guiding individuals away from the throes of addiction and toward healthier lifestyles. Today, these centers are recognized for their effectiveness in reducing relapse rates and improving the overall wellbeing of those in recovery.

Different Services Offered by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ver

Detoxification ServicesDetoxification is often the first step in the recovery journey at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ver. During this phase, patients undergo medically supervised withdrawal from substances, ensuring their safety and comfort. This process is crucial as it helps to manage withdrawal symptoms effectively, providing individuals with a solid foundation before they engage in further treatment. Facilities are equipped with experienced medical staff who monitor patients closely, adjusting care as necessary. This attentive supervision not only aids physical recovery but also fosters a sense of trust and security, allowing patients to begin addressing their psychological dependence on substances.
Inpatient TreatmentInpatient treatment programs at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ver provide a comprehensive, immersive experience for individuals seeking recovery. Patients stay within the facility, participating in structured daily schedules that include therapy sessions, medication management, and group activities. This setting is particularly beneficial for those with severe addictions or co-occurring mental health disorders, as the concentrated environment minimizes distractions and enables individuals to focus entirely on their healing. With constant access to trained professionals, patients can build a supportive network and develop essential coping skills that further enhance their recovery journey.
Outpatient TreatmentOutpatient treatment allows individuals to receive care while still attending to personal responsibilities such as work and family.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ver offer various outpatient programs, including regular counseling sessions, medication management, and support groups. This flexibility is vital for those who may not need intensive inpatient care yet still require assistance on their path to recovery. Outpatient services encourage individuals to apply the skills they learn in therapy to their everyday lives, enabling them to reinforce positive changes and maintain accountability in their sobriety.
12 Step and Non-12 Step ProgramsRehab centers for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ver provide options for both 12 Step and non-12 Step approaches, recognizing that recovery is not a one-size-fits-all journey. The 12 Step method, popularized by Alcoholics Anonymous, emphasizes shared experiences and spiritual growth as part of recovery. Alternately, non-12 Step programs focus on evidence-based practices and self-empowerment, appealing to those who may prefer a more individualized approach. By offering both types of programs, these centers ensure that patients can choose a path that resonates with their values and needs, which can significantly enhance their commitment to the recovery process.
Counseling and TherapyCounseling and therapy are pivotal components within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ver, tailored to address the emotional and psychological aspects of addiction. Professional therapists help patients uncover underlying issues that contribute to substance use, guiding them through techniques like cognitive-behavioral therapy and motivational interviewing. These therapeutic interventions empower individuals to rethink negative patterns, develop healthier coping strategies, and build resilience. By fostering a safe space for honest discussions, counseling also helps to rebuild relationships often strained by addiction, reinforcing supportive connections that are essential for long-term recovery.
Aftercare ServicesAftercare services are crucial in facilitating lasting recovery after leaving a Medication-assisted Treatment rehab center in Denver. These programs may include ongoing therapy sessions, support groups, and specialized programs tailored to maintain sobriety beyond the intensive treatment phase. With relapse being a common challenge in recovery, structured aftercare plans provide patients with the resources they need to navigate potential triggers and maintain accountability. The continuity of care ensures that individuals transitioning back into their everyday lives have a reliable support system to lean on as they consolidate their recovery efforts.
Cost of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ver
Insurance CoverageMost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ver accept a variety of insurance plans, which can significantly reduce out-of-pocket costs for families seeking treatment. Coverage typically includes detoxification, counseling sessions, medication management, and aftercare services. Patients are encouraged to verify their specific coverage with insurance providers to understand what services are included under their plan. This proactive approach to financial planning not only alleviates the immediate burden but also instills confidence in individuals and their families, knowing that quality care is accessible without excessive financial strain.
Payment PlansRecognizing the financial barriers that can accompany addiction treatment, many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ver offer flexible payment plans designed to accommodate different financial situations. These plans may allow for monthly payments or sliding scale fees based on income, ensuring that more individuals can access essential services. By providing structured payment options, these centers empower patients to seek the help they need without the added stress of immediate financial burden, fostering a more sensible approach to recovery that is sustainable in the long run.
Government GrantsSome rehab centers for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ver participate in government programs that provide grants and funding aimed at supporting addiction recovery. These grants can help cover the costs of treatment for individuals who are uninsured or underfunded. Patients seeking assistance through government grants can benefit greatly as they pursue recovery without the anxiety of financial obstacles. This support is essential for increasing access to quality treatment options, ultimately saving lives and allowing individuals to overcome their addiction challenges.
Financial Assistance ProgramsMany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ers offer financial assistance programs aimed at providing additional support for patients and their families. These programs may include scholarships or sliding scale fees that reduce the cost of treatment based on an individual’s financial situation. Such assistance helps bridge the gap for those who may struggle with the costs associated with recovery, ensuring that nobody is denied the care they need due to financial restrictions. This commitment to accessible treatment underscores the importance of community wellness and recovery support.
HSA and FSA OptionsHealth savings accounts (HSAs) and flexible spending accounts (FSAs) are financial tools that can be utilized to pay for treatment at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ver. Patients can withdraw pre-tax funds to cover qualified medical expenses, including counseling and medication management services. Utilizing HSA and FSA accounts can ease the financial strain associated with addiction treatment, thus allowing individuals to focus on their recovery rather than the costs of care. It’s an advantageous option that promotes smart financial management in handling health-related concerns.
Charity ProgramsNumerous nonprofit organizations collaborate with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ver to offer charity programs designed to provide financial support to individuals seeking addiction treatment services. These charities seek donations and grants to help fund treatment for those in need, creating opportunities for recovery that would otherwise be inaccessible. By participating in these programs, individuals can overcome financial barriers and receive the necessary support to embark on their recovery journeys, reaffirming the essential message that help is available to anyone ready for change.

Key Considerations for Medication-assisted Treatment in Denver

1
Types of Addiction TreatedWhen selecting a Medication-assisted Treatment rehab center in Denver, it is essential to consider the specific types of addiction the facility specializes in. Some centers may focus primarily on opioid addiction, while others might be geared toward alcohol use disorders or dual diagnosis cases involving mental health challenges. Understanding the scope of treatment options available ensures that individuals receive targeted and effective care tailored to their unique challenges. This consideration is critical in aligning one's recovery journey with the right center and enhancing the likelihood of successful outcomes.
2
Qualifications of StaffThe qualifications and experience of the staff at a Medication-assisted Treatment rehab center in Denver play a pivotal role in the treatment process. It’s vital to ensure that the team includes board-certified physicians, licensed therapists, and trained addiction specialists. A knowledgeable and compassionate staff not only equips individuals with medical care but also provides emotional support throughout the recovery journey. Inquiry about credentials, experience in addiction treatment, and the staff-to-patient ratio can provide insights into the quality of care and support available.
3
Success Rates of ProgramsBefore choosing a Medication-assisted Treatment rehab center in Denver, individuals should investigate the success rates associated with their programs. Metrics such as the percentage of individuals completing treatment, rates of relapse, and duration of sobriety post-treatment can offer valuable insights into the effectiveness of the facility’s methods. Transparency in success rates indicates a commitment to accountability and patient outcomes, thus enabling individuals to make educated decisions regarding their recovery journeys based on performance.
4
Duration of Treatment ProgramsThe duration of treatment programs available at Medication-assisted Treatment rehab centers in Denver is an important factor to consider prior to enrolling. Some treatment plans may last for a few weeks, while others extend to several months or more. Each person's recovery journey is unique, and understanding the timeline allows individuals to prepare accordingly and align treatment with their needs. Having flexibility in treatment duration ensures that patients are not rushed through the recovery process, encouraging a more thorough healing experience.
